Fred (Frederick Harold) Cress (1938-2009)
signed, dated and titled verso: 'Cress 2004 / THE ART OF FOOD 2004'
synthetic polymer paint on canvas
137.0 x 168.0cm (53 15/16 x 66 1/8in).
Footnotes
PROVENANCE
The Lucio's Collection, Sydney
Everyone has a favourite restaurant - mine is Lucio's.
Cities around the world boast restaurants that become legendary because they are where artists and writers meet and the movers and shakers of society have chosen to eat. Lucio's is of that calibre.
It is not hard to understand why, either. Fuelled by the excellent food and art on the walls, the atmosphere is always lively. On entering the restaurant you feel a tingle of anticipation for an enjoyable evening ahead, one that will engage all your senses.
Lucio has a way of making you feel immediately at home, somehow relaxed, receptive. His 'team' of waiters, surely the best in Sydney, conduct themselves with a blend of friendliness and skilful service that seems effortless - such is their ability.
Finally, of course, a restaurant will survive on the excellence of its food. Lucio's secret is fundamental to all great establishments - the best ingredients served fresh and simply, having a balance of tastes with nothing overwhelming anything else.
Living in France for half of the year, I have to admit to missing Lucio's. Surrounded as I am by many reputedly great restaurants, I still dream of returning to Sydney to savour the Salmon Tartare with Sevruga Caviar of the Grilled Figs with Mushrooms, or the Green Tagliolini with Blue Swimmer Crab. To follow, possibly the Duck, the Rack of Lamb, or maybe the Veal Medallions he does so well. Just writing this has made me hungry as I picture it all in my mind.
Like a migratory bird comes late September, I head home, for the sunshine, the warmth and Lucio's!
Fred Cress, 1999
